How to uninstall AMD Radeon Settings from your system

This web page contains thorough information on how to uninstall AMD Radeon Settings for Windows. It is produced by Advanced Micro Devices, Inc.. Further information on Advanced Micro Devices, Inc. can be found here. More info about the software AMD Radeon Settings can be seen at . Usually the AMD Radeon Settings program is installed in the C:\Program Files\AMD folder, depending on the user's option during setup. RadeonSettings.exe is the programs's main file and it takes circa 8.92 MB (9355656 bytes) on disk.

The following executable files are contained in AMD Radeon Settings. They take 13.58 MB (14241224 bytes) on disk.

  • cncmd.exe (50.88 KB)
  • gpuup.exe (297.38 KB)
  • installShell64.exe (336.00 KB)
  • MMLoadDrv.exe (30.38 KB)
  • MMLoadDrvPXDiscrete.exe (30.38 KB)
  • QtWebProcess.exe (30.38 KB)
  • RadeonSettings.exe (8.92 MB)
  • TwitchAPIWrapper.exe (41.88 KB)
  • YoutubeAPIWrapper.exe (26.38 KB)
  • amdprw.exe (391.88 KB)
  • PRWlayer.exe (177.50 KB)
  • RadeonInstaller.exe (2.98 MB)
  • amdacpinstutil.exe (190.00 KB)
  • amdacpusrsvc.exe (119.00 KB)
